What companies run services between Amadora, Portugal and Lisbon Sete Rios, Portugal?
Comboios de Portugal operates a train from Reboleira to Sete Rios every 20 minutes. Tickets cost €1–2 and the journey takes 7 min. Alternatively, Carris operates a bus from Estação Damaia to Sete Rios every 30 minutes. Tickets cost €3 and the journey takes 16 min.
